Enum Constant Details
-
ANNOTATION
The source of configuration are annotation in the source code -
XML
The source of configuration is XML configuration -
API
The source of configuration is the programmatic API

getPriority
public int getPriority()Returns this sources priority. Can be used to determine which configuration shall apply in case of conflicting configurations by several providers.- Returns:
- This source's priority.
-
max
Returns that configuration source from the given two sources, which has the higher priority.- Parameters:
a
- A configuration source.b
- Another configuration source.- Returns:
- The source with the higher priority. Will be source
a
if both have the same priority.
